apply principles of building proteins to health
you are in a laboratory attempting to identify a genetic defect responsible for a disease. you believe you have located the gene that results in a faulty protein—but you arent sure!
how could you be sure you have located a section of dna that encodes for a protein?
x write down the sequence to see what amino acids might be linked together.
allow the dna to be transcribed to rna and see what protein results.
compare the faulty protein to the dna.
retry

Explanation:

Brief Explanations

DNA is transcribed to RNA during protein - synthesis. By allowing the DNA to be transcribed to RNA and observing the resulting protein, one can confirm if the DNA section encodes for a protein. Just writing down the sequence might not be conclusive as it doesn't show the actual protein - building process. Comparing the faulty protein to the DNA directly doesn't confirm if the DNA section is the one encoding for the protein.

Answer:

Allow the DNA to be transcribed to RNA and see what protein results.
